Plus, this was basically my last opportunity to get back to my job before governement regulations changed. If I had waited longer, I would have lost my certification, and because I was trained on the job, I would not have been able to be employed any longer in my field - crazy but true! They are changing the legislation so that only those who have gone to college for Pharmacy technician can become certified and work in a pharmacy. This is going to begin in 2010. All currently employed technicians, who have enough hours each year, will be 'safe' and can continue to work. Next step of the process is becoming a Registered pharmacy tech and as soon as they roll out the courses online (they've already begun running courses at various community colleges) I'll be moving forward for that!
